The Importance of Supplier Relationships
In the realm of B2B wholesale, strong supplier relationships are essential for long-term success. These connections can influence product quality, pricing, and the overall customer experience.
Establishing Trust and Communication
Building a successful relationship with suppliers begins with trust. Open communication fosters transparency and helps avoid misunderstandings that could disrupt the supply chain.
Negotiating Terms and Conditions
It's crucial to negotiate fair terms and conditions that benefit both parties. This includes pricing, delivery schedules, and payment terms, which can greatly affect business operations.
Investing in Partnerships
Consider suppliers as partners rather than just sources of products. Investing time and resources into these relationships can yield long-term benefits, including better pricing and exclusive access to new products.

Ensuring Quality and Compliance
Working closely with suppliers ensures that the products meet quality standards and comply with regulations, which is critical for maintaining customer satisfaction.
Reviewing and Adjusting Relationships
Regularly reviewing supplier performance and being open to adjustments can prevent potential issues and strengthen the partnership over time.
